A dental crown is a custom-made “cap” that is placed over a damaged tooth. It fully encases the visible portion of the tooth above the gum line, restoring its shape, size, strength, and appearance. Once cemented in place, a crown becomes the tooth’s new outer surface.

We believe in providing the right restoration for your individual needs. Dr. Scott will recommend the best crown material based on the tooth’s location, your bite, aesthetic goals, and personal preferences.
Best For : A balance of strength and aesthetics, often used for back teeth where durability is key but a natural look is still desired.
Our Approach : These crowns have a strong metal substructure for durability, fused with an outer layer of tooth-colored porcelain. Dr. Scott carefully designs them to provide a reliable and cost-effective restoration.
Best For : The highest level of aesthetic excellence, ideal for front teeth or patients with metal sensitivities who desire a perfectly natural appearance.
Our Approach : Crafted from high-strength, translucent ceramic materials like lithium disilicate (e.max), these crowns offer exceptional beauty and biocompatibility. They reflect light like natural tooth enamel, making them virtually undetectable in your smile.
Best For : Unmatched strength and durability for back teeth, or for patients with a strong bite who need a resilient, long-lasting solution.
Our Approach : Zirconia is an incredibly strong ceramic material. Our custom-milled zirconia crowns are both tough enough to withstand chewing forces and can be beautifully layered with porcelain for a natural, aesthetic result—perfect for Mobile patients seeking a “best of both worlds” option.


Best For : Superior durability with minimal tooth removal, often recommended for out-of-sight molars or for patients who prefer this time-tested material.
Our Approach : While less common for cosmetic reasons, gold crowns are renowned for their longevity and gentle wear against opposing teeth. Dr. Scott will discuss this durable option if it is clinically advantageous for your specific situation.

At Spring Hill Dental Health Center, receiving your dental crown is a streamlined, predictable process focused on your comfort.
We begin with a thorough examination, including digital X-rays. Dr. Scott will prepare the tooth by removing any decay and shaping it to securely fit the crown. A precise digital impression is then taken using our CAD/CAM scanner.
A temporary crown is placed to protect your prepared tooth. Your digital scan is used to design and mill your permanent crown, either in our in-house lab or at our trusted partner lab, ensuring meticulous craftsmanship.
At your second visit, the temporary crown is removed. Dr. Scott will carefully check the fit, color, and bite of your new permanent crown. Once you are completely satisfied, it is permanently cemented into place.
For eligible cases, we offer the convenience of CEREC® same-day crowns. This advanced technology allows us to design, mill, and place your custom ceramic crown in a single appointment, eliminating the need for a temporary.

Care for your crowned tooth just like your natural teeth, with twice-daily brushing and daily flossing. Pay special attention to the area where the crown meets the gum line.
After the anesthesia wears off and any initial sensitivity subsides, you can eat normally. Avoid chewing extremely hard items (like ice or hard candy) on the crown to prevent damage.
Regular dental checkups and cleanings at our office are essential. We will monitor the health of your crown, the underlying tooth, and the surrounding gums to ensure its continued success.

With good oral hygiene and regular dental care, most crowns last between 10 and 15 years, though many last significantly longer.
The procedure is performed under local anesthesia, so you should not feel pain. We also offer sedation dentistry for patients with dental anxiety to ensure a relaxed experience.
A filling repairs a cavity by “filling in” the hole. A crown is used when a tooth is too damaged for a filling; it covers and protects the entire visible portion of the tooth.
Yes, decay can start at the margin where the crown meets the tooth. Excellent oral hygiene and regular checkups are vital to prevent this.
